Subject: User-module cut-over complete

Hi — welcome aboard. Quick summary since you'll be touching this area. Last night we finished splitting the user module out of the Fernwheel monolith into its own service, Userloft. Traffic is fully cut over; the monolith's user routes now proxy to Userloft and will be deleted next sprint. Rollback is still possible via the proxy flag. Userloft is running in production with the configuration below.

settings of bawif-fawif:
ralix:
  log_level: warn
  metrics_host: metrics.ralix.tolvaqsys.internal
  pool_size: 32

**Canary gating — quick refresher for the sync**

Hey folks, reminder on how Pondskip gates canaries: we hold at 5% traffic until error rate stays under 0.3% for 15 minutes, then auto-ramp to 25%, then 100%. If latency p95 drifts more than 12% over baseline, Wrenfield's bot rolls it back automatically — don't fight it, just re-cut. Marnie asked that nobody override the gate manually without pinging the on-call first. The exact thresholds the bot reads live in the settings below.

service settings:
[silwyn]
host = silwyn.crelvogrid.internal
user = silwyn_svc
database = silwyn_prod

Welcome to on-call for the Glimmerpane design system! Our snapshot tests live in the `snapcheck` suite and run on every merge to main. If a UI component changes visually, the diff bot flags it — usually it's an intentional tweak, so just approve the new baseline. If it's 2am and snapshots are failing across the board, it's almost always a font-loading race, not your problem. To unlock the baseline store and re-approve snapshots in bulk, use the recovery passphrase below.

recovery phrase for tahag-taguf: wenix-caswyn